## Further reading

So you've inherited Inkspool, our printer-spooler microservice. Sorry, and also congratulations. The short version: it queues render jobs from the Bramblehurst office fleet, retries flaky printers three times, and then quietly gives up in ways that will confuse you. Most of the weird behavior is intentional — there are comments, but the real context lives in the design notes and the incident history. Before you refactor the retry loop (everyone tries), read the archaeology doc first, which we keep here.

runbook for badug-kadup: https://confluence.zemvarlabs.internal/projects/browse/display/projects/bd1b

### Driver-assignment heuristic rework

This PR replaces Kerrimond's nearest-driver greedy match with a weighted score combining ETA, driver idle time, and zone fairness. Rollout is behind the `assign_v2` flag, default off. If assignment latency spikes on-call, flip the flag back; no data migration involved. The weights were fit against last quarter's Dunmore-region trips and are intentionally conservative. All tunables live in one config block, reproduced below.

constants for tafog-kahag:
RATE_LIMITS = {
    "sorir": 697,
    "oliox": 683,
    "holax": 176,
    "casox": 60,
    "pelius": 382,
}

## Deployment

Feedcheckle runs fine as a single container — no database needed, just a writable cache dir. Plugin authors: your validators are loaded at startup, so redeploy after dropping a new plugin into the plugins folder. Hot reload is on the roadmap, don't hold your breath. To get a working instance, start the container with the configuration values listed below.

service settings:
novath:
  pin: 1396
  tenant: pelys
  seal: seal_ccc035e1
  metrics_host: metrics.novath.qorvelworks.test
  standby_team: fraeth
  escalation: drueth-zorok
  nonce: 61d508

Document Transport — Signed Contracts. Signed originals moving between the Ashgate and Rowell offices must travel in sealed opaque envelopes inside the blue courier wallet. Log each movement in the transfer register and obtain a receiving signature. Only Brindle Dispatch drivers are approved. At collection, the driver must carry out the hand-over as stated below.

drop instructions, bagug-kagup: the rusath julmir courier leaves the ralwyn aldok eliius ledger at gate 8603 under passcode 993062